THE UNITED STATES.

PRESIDENT TAFT’S ACCESSION. THE new Cabinet. U/ited Press Association. Copyright NEW YORK, March 3. Mr. Taft, who enters office as Pre-' sident to-morrow, lias appointed the following Cabinet-; ' Mr P. C. Knox, Secretary of State... Tfr. FrankfinHeveagh, Secretary of the Treasury. Mr. Dickinson, Secretary for War. Mr Wickersham, Attprn.eyfGcneral. Mr." G. Meyer, Secretary to the Navy. Mr. Bellinger, Secretary of. the Intenor. ' Mr. J. Wilson, Secretary of Agriculture. Mrr • E;. Hitehcock, 7’'PostrnasterGenefalv Mr: C. Nagel, Secretary' of Commerce," ' 'YU [Only two members* of "'the new Cabinet were in that of - President Roosevelt—Messrs Meyer'and Wilson, who held the portfolios which they liavie 'in the. present one.].A" ' : U
